el-upload允许多选
时间: 2023-12-23 20:27:54 浏览: 163
多图选择、多图上传
5星 · 资源好评率100%
el-upload是Element UI库中的一个组件,用于实现文件上传功能。默认情况下,el-upload组件只允许选择单个文件进行上传。如果需要允许多选文件上传,可以通过设置el-upload组件的multiple属性来实现。
具体步骤如下:
1. 在使用el-upload组件的地方,添加multiple属性,将其设置为true,表示允许多选文件。
2. 设置el-upload组件的limit属性,用于限制最大可选择的文件数量。可以根据需求设置合适的值。
3. 在上传成功后的回调函数中,可以通过获取到的文件列表来处理多个文件的上传结果。
下面是一个示例代码:
```
<template>
<el-upload
action="/upload"
multiple
:limit="3"
:on-success="handleSuccess"
>
<el-button size="small" type="primary">点击上传</el-button>
</el-upload>
</template>
<script>
export default {
methods: {
handleSuccess(response, file, fileList) {
// 处理上传成功后的逻辑
console.log(fileList);
}
}
}
</script>
```
在上面的示例中,el-upload组件设置了multiple属性为true,表示允许多选文件。同时,设置了limit属性为3,表示最多可选择3个文件进行上传。在handleSuccess方法中,通过fileList参数获取到上传成功的文件列表。
阅读全文